description Introduction: Chronic diseases are presently a public health problem on the rise. Objective: To describe the socio-demographic characteristics of and the stressing factors affecting the professional nurses. Methods: Descriptive, quantitative, cross-sectional study of 105 nurses who care for chronically-ill patients in health care institutions located in Santa Marta. The socio-demographic characterization instrument and the nursing stress scale were both used. The statistical package called IBM SPSS Statistics version 21.0 served to process information by using summary statistics. Results: The age of 45 % of nurses ranged 31 to 40 years; women predominated with 88 % of participants; 47 % was hired on a fixed term contract and 24 % on an unspecified term and most of the interviewed participants said that work relations caused moderate tension. Conclusions: The stress affecting the nursing professionals, who care for chronically-ill patients, is related to personal and working factors and to direct care of patients. © 2019 Revista Cubana de Enfermería.
